Home > cat > path 
 en fr de es nl pl pt pt_BR mk sq ca hu cs tr ar fa id vi ko ja ru zh zh_TW eo
Precedente  Successivo  Modifica  Rinomina  Undo  Refresh  Search  Amministrazione  
Documentazione
History
 
Attenzione! Questa pagina non è aggiornata.  Vedi versione in inglese 
Percorsi di File e Directory
Questi sono due tipi possibili di percorsi per i file e le directory in Gambas:

Percorso assoluto:

Il percorso assoluto, inizia con un carettere / o un carattere ~. Questi sono considerati in maniera identica alla shell.

Se un percorso iniza con il carattere ~ seguito da un carattere /, allora il carattere ~ viene sostituito con il percorso della home directory dell'utente. Se invece il percorso inizia con un ~ ma non è seguito da un carattere /, allora i caratteri inseriti fino alla barra successiva devono essere il nome dell'utente. Questi allora saranno sostituiti con la home dell'utente.

Esempio:

Percorso in Gambas Corrisponde al percorso
~/Desktop /home/benoit/Desktop
~root/Desktop /root/Desktop

Attenzione! Non usate mai le directory con il percorso assoluto nei vostri progetti, perché questi percorsi non saranno presi in considerazione quando il progetto viene compilato. Poiché questi percorsi non esisteranno una volta fatto l'eseguibile, è necessario al suo posto usare il precorso relativo.

Percorsi relativi:

Un percorso relativo è un percorso che non inizia con un carattere /. Questi si riferiscono a file o directory posizionati all'interno del progetto corrente o del componente (componenti) corrente.

Attenzione! I percorsi relativi, non si riferiscono a files che si trovano all'interno della directory di lavoro corrente, in quanto non esiste un concetto di directory di lavoro corrente in Gambas!

Tutti i files posizionati all'interno del progetto corrente, vengono effettivamente archiaviati all'interno di un file eseguibile di tipo read-only (a sola lettura).

Attenzione! Quando si è in fase di sviluppo di un progetto sarebbe possibile utilizzare i percorsi assoluti, in quanto in questa fase Gambas lo permetterebbe. MA NON FATELO! Infatti una volta che avrete terminato il progetto e produrrete un file eseguibile, questo non funzionerà in quanto in percorsi assoluti verranno persi.

Se avete necessità di accedere a files posizionati nel vostro progetto da un componente, questo è possibile. Dovete semplicemente iniziare il vostro percorso relativo con la sequenza di ../.